>>>>> "James" == James Bottomley <James.Bottomley@suse.de> writes:
>> Correct. It's quite unlikely for pages to be contiguous so this is
>> the best we can do.
James> Actually, average servers do about 50% contiguous on average
James> since we changed the mm layer to allocate in ascending physical
James> page order ... this figure is highly sensitive to mm changes
James> though, and can vary from release to release.
Interesting. When did this happen?
Last time I gathered data on segment merge efficiency (1 year+ ago) I
found that adjacent pages were quite rare for a normal fs type workload.
Certainly not in the 50% ballpark. I'll take another look when I have a
moment...
